Q: Is 230,423,139 a Prime Number?
A: No, 230,423,139 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 230423139 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 3,907 6,553 11,721 19,659 35,163 58,977 25,602,571 76,807,713 and 230,423,139, with no remainder.
Since 230,423,139 cannot be divided by just 1 and 230,423,139, it is not a prime number.
